Biodynamics, in a nutshell, is an extreme method organic farming, which invovles creating a vineyard or an estate into its own micro-ecosystem. This method of viticulture interests us more so than conventional organic farming, as vignerons who practice this method are convinced that wines made from biodynamically grown grapes have a more pronounced expression of terroir. Biodynamics is certified the ‘Demeter’, their symbol can sometimes, but not always found on biodynamic wines. The cornerstone of Biodynamics is the 9 compost preparations and sprays, which are named 500 – 508. The composts are totally natural and the spray, composed of quartz and cow horn, is diluted to almost homeopathic like concentration. Biodynamic wines are not only friendly to the environment as insects, birds and wild flora are encouraged in the system, but also, largely, vignerons who practice this method are also highly conscientious viticulturists, who work hard in the vineyard, and seek to produce wines that have balance and purity and express their sense of place.
